Frequently Asked Questions about Champaign
How much are Studio apartments in Champaign?
There are currently 98 Studio Apartments in Champaign with rent ranges from $615 to $2,290 with an average price of $1,464.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Champaign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Champaign ranges from $499 to $2,200 with an average monthly rent of $1,303.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Champaign c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Champaign range from $685 to $2,655.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,417.
How expensive are Champaign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 162 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Champaign on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$785 to $2,900 - averaging $1,520 for the location.
